hey ladies, i’m just posting for someone to talk to or give me any advice really, been ttc with my fiancé for 9 months, he’s 27, i’m 21, he’s had someone pregnant before and i’ve been pregnant before in the past. He recently did a sperm test which came back fine, i had blood tests on cycle day 2 to see if i produce the hormones needed, and progesterone tests after ovulation etc, and all the results came back fine and they’ve confirmed i’m ovulating... so i’m really confused, what do you think could be going on? I’m at a “normal” weight too.. we dtd more than enough so it’s just breaking my heart every month to see one line. opinions anyone? I’m so baffled :( xx

I know its frustrating and worrying, but it is completely normal to take up to a year to conceive, even with zero issues on either side! Sometimes people just get unlucky.

Just to check a couple of other things - that you dont undereat or exercise excessively?
